ABSTRACT:
Systems, methods and software products identify emerging issues from textual customer feedback. A message stream of customer feedback is received. The message stream includes a plurality of unstructured text messages from at least one homogeneous source. A time interval is established. The volume of text messages for the time interval is determined to establish a reference volume. The volume of text messages in subsequent time intervals is measured to establish a trend volume. The trend volume is compared to the reference volume to determine a volumetric change. At least one action is initiated in response to a volumetric change above a pre-determined threshold. At least one action is initiated in response to a volumetric change below a pre-determined threshold.
